A lot of experts advocate a vegetarian diet, claiming it to be the ultimate food regime. Two of the many different veggie diets are the regular vegetarian, who stays clear of meats; and the vegan, who simply does not eat any meat product, including eggs and dairy. Some of the experts claim that vegetarians are given certain benefits where heart disease and cancer are concerned. While you should beware of eating an overabundance of carbs, also be sure to eat plenty of protein. Having success with a vegetarian diet can be accomplished, but only by realizing that it is critical to maintain a balanced diet with needed nutrients.

Some folks center their attention on fat reduction. Some fat is still necessary to maintain a balanced diet even when you opt for a low fat diet, low being the key word. Oils are an important element to your health, without overdoing, you can get these valuable oils in fish, olive and flaxseed. Nuts and legumes can also be healthy sources of fat. The saturated fats that are not a healthy product and should be eaten as little as possible, their ingested when eating animal products or trans fats.

Even though you will almost certainly lose weight if you go on a fast or cleanse for a week or more, you'll also gain most of this back when you go back to your regular diet. As you can see, diets may be more useful in the long term if you modify what you eat instead of going one from time to time. Diets that cleanse you internally can definitely help, but the results will not remain for long.

Losing weight requires both the right diet and plenty of exercise, so don't be fooled by those who say you only need a good diet. Limiting your daily calorific intake to an unhealthy level could make you lose weight, however you will put on all of the weight you lost really easy once you start eating properly again. Both a balance of exercise and a proper diet will make sure you lose weight efficiently as well as safely. Sticking to an exercise regime is great but you can aid your weight loss by doing extra things in the day, things such as taking walks during your lunch breaks.
